「知识库」关于Frp内网穿透知识的拾漏补缺

Frp是什么,怎么配置这类基础问题自己去搜,网上成篇累牍的教程本文不再赘述,如果你遇到下面这个棘手的问题,那么我们可以一起讨论一下:

Frp服务原理

问题症状:

前提:Frp穿透完成,你在内网发布了网站,网站也能被公网用户正常访问;

问题复现:如果你做小程序开发、公众号开发、或者调用某些第三方api的时候,对方往往会要求你设置一个IP白名单(对方出于安全考虑仅仅白名单内的IP进行通信)。这时候Frp的兄弟就抓瞎了(如果有固定的公网IP还搞什么Frp呢)……

Frp目前解决的是外网穿透至内网,使你内网的服务可以通过Frp发布出来;简单地说就是:外 to 内 (反向代理)

而你内网web应用如果调用第三方api的时候(也就是内网对外上网),仍然走的是本地网络连接,你是无法通过Frp服务端的IP连接互联网的。(正向代理)

我翻遍了互联网,Frp好像没有正向代理的功能,偶尔有一个篇提起Frp正向代理的文章,说的也含含糊糊。

结论:如果你有上述需求,你也就别有什么幻想了,乖乖的——

1、在Frp服务端(公网服务端)再架设一个正向代理服务。

2、在Frp客户端(也就是内网)装一个全局代理服务(Proxifier),然后本地(内网)的所有外连请求都会从公网IP发出。

这样就可以实现双向代理了,说真的我觉得这个方法实在不优雅,多希望一个Frp两头都搞定,我是没找到更好的方法了,各位师兄有啥高招,欢迎讨论。

展开阅读全文

页面更新:2024-04-29

标签:公网   都会   棘手   高招   两头   知识库   服务端   也就是   名单   方法   知识   网站

1 2 3 4 5

上滑加载更多 ↓
推荐阅读:
友情链接:
更多:

本站资料均由网友自行发布提供,仅用于学习交流。如有版权问题,请与我联系,QQ:4156828  

© CopyRight 2008-2024 All Rights Reserved. Powered By bs178.com 闽ICP备11008920号-3
闽公网安备35020302034844号

Top